Electrical faults in a residential system frequently present early indicators that are easy to dismiss as minor inconveniences, but these symptoms typically reflect underlying conditions that deteriorate with continued use rather than stabilizing on their own. The following warning signs suggest that a licensed electrician should evaluate your home's electrical system promptly.
An outlet or switch that fails intermittently or stops functioning entirely may indicate a failed device, a loose wiring connection, a tripped GFCI upstream on the circuit, or a fault in the circuit wiring itself. Advanced Home Services can trace the fault to its origin and perform the appropriate electrical repair to restore reliable function without guesswork.
Visible sparking or a persistent burning smell at an electrical device is an indication that arcing is occurring at a connection or within the wiring, which is a condition that requires immediate electrician repair attention to prevent fire. Advanced Home Services treats these symptoms as urgent and prioritizes inspection and correction when homeowners throughout the region report them.
Circuits that lose power without a breaker trip typically point to a wiring fault, a failed connection inside a junction box, or a deteriorated splice that has opened under load. Advanced Home Services locates the break in the circuit through systematic testing and performs the electrical repair necessary to restore continuous, protected power to the affected area.
Voltage fluctuations that correlate with specific loads or occur at predictable intervals suggest a loose connection at the panel, a failing neutral conductor, or a wiring deficiency that causes the circuit to perform inconsistently under varying current draw. Our electricians use structured testing procedures that follow the circuit from the panel through each device in sequence, confirming voltage, continuity, and ground integrity at each point until the fault is located. This methodical approach ensures that the electrical repair corrects the actual cause of the problem rather than a downstream effect that may recur if the source is not addressed.
A burning odor from a wall or outlet suggests that arcing or heat buildup is occurring within the wiring or device, and the circuit should be turned off at the panel immediately if it is safe to do so. Permit requirements depend on the scope of the repair; straightforward device replacements typically do not require a permit, while repairs that involve wiring corrections, junction box modifications, or panel work are more likely to fall under permit requirements in Idaho jurisdictions.
